Big Five Traits
Refers to the five main facets of human personality, including openness to experience, conscientiousness, extraversion, agreeableness, and emotional stability.
Major Depressive Episode
A period characterized by a severely depressed mood and/or loss of interest or pleasure in life's activities, lasting for at least two weeks.
Symptoms
Signs or indicators of a medical condition or disease, often reported by the patient.
Pathological Behaviors
Actions or reactions that are maladaptive and indicative of some form of psychological disorder.
